    Easter Tennis Camps

    This Easter Wells Tennis Club will be running tennis camps for juniors age 5yrs and above.  The sessions will be split into Mini Red (5-8yrs), Mini Orange  and Green (8-10yrs) & Junior Tennis (11yrs+). Mini Tennis Red Mini Orange & Green Week 1 Week 2…
